The aging process can be influenced by environmental, genetic, and nutritional factors. There are several food products that can accelerate the onset of wrinkles due to their pro-inflammatory properties, their ability to cause oxidative stress, DNA damage, hormone disruption, or the accumulation of toxins in the body. But what exactly are these products?

Which products accelerate aging?

Excess salt can induce high blood pressure, stroke, and damage blood vessels. Moreover, salt can cause water retention, resulting in edema and swelling. In a similar manner, overconsumption of sugar can negatively impact not only the condition of the skin but also the general health of an individual. Specifically, sugar can cause glycation – a process that damages proteins like collagen and elastin, and leads to an increase in insulin levels that can, in turn, cause inflammation of the skin.

Processed foods such as fast food are saturated in fats, cholesterol, salt, and sugar. These can increase the risk of obesity, diabetes, heart disease, and various forms of cancer. Fast food also tends to lower antioxidant levels in the body, thereby promoting cell aging. Alcohol is also a factor that contributes to accelerated aging. It dehydrates the body and the skin which causes it to lose firmness and wrinkles to form. Alcohol can also cause damage to the liver, the organ responsible for detoxifying the body.

Foods cooked on a grill can contain compounds known as heterocyclic amines. These are carcinogenic and can accelerate cell aging, along with causing inflammation in the body that can lead to chronic diseases. Furthermore, deep-fried food can contain a significant amount of trans fats which increase levels of 'bad' cholesterol, decrease 'good' cholesterol, and heighten the risk of heart disease. Deep-fried foods can also contain aldehydes that are toxic to cells and DNA.

How to originate a nutritive regimen that ages us slower?

In order to decelerate the aging process, it's suggested to cut back on the consumption of the foods mentioned above and replace them with healthier alternatives. Consuming larger quantities of vegetables, fruits, nuts, seeds, fish, and olive oil, all of which are jewel-encrusted with antioxidants, vitamins, minerals, fibre, and omega-3 fatty acids, is highly advised. Nutrients like these can help protect cells from damage, prevent inflammation, increase immune system function, control blood sugar and cholesterol levels, aid brain and heart function, and moreover improve skin appearance and elasticity.
